The art of fretwork began more than 3,000 years ago in Egypt and was used widely in decorative art and architecture. Greek fretwork, also known as key patterns, have been among the oldest and most popular patterns throughout human history. The Kori Earrings in cross-brushed 18K Gold Vermeil were inspired by this ancient art and the handmade chain compliments our love for vintage jewellery.
